: Thanks. A couple of additional questions concerning the save functions provided. What's additionally saved when 'save portfolio' is used instead of 'save all investments'?


Hi Steve,

Saving your portfolio saves the *.mm4 portfolio file you're using. Saving investments saves the *.dat investment files.

The investment files contain your pricing and transaction data for each investment. Each investment has its own investment file. For more on investments, see:

About Investments

The *.mm4 portfolio file saves your sub-portfolio definitions, which investments are included in each sub-portfolio, and all of your workspace settings, like which windows are open, etc. For more on portfolio files see:
